We introduce you to Julie Freeman! The quote "Though she be little, she is fierce", so accurately describes this passionately principled volunteer. When she chooses where she will devote her time, she does so wisely, as she focuses on whatever she's committed to with her heart, mind and soul. We are thrilled to say she's coming back for another round as one of our Parent Education co-chairs next year!

***ABOUT JULIE***

Her children: 
I have 2 daughters in the district, one in 3rd grade and one in 6th.


Her position on the PTO Board: 
Co-chair of Parent Education

Year started as a PTO Board member:
2013-2014

Employment status:
I own a promotion products/Marketing company Jelli Goods, with my husband. I work part time, managing the finances for the company and I spend one day a week working in our retail store.

How do you fit in PTO projects into your routine?
My team meets once a month, usually over lunch (you gotta eat, right?) to discuss events we are working on for the district. I am able to do much of the planning and prep work at home on my own time.

What do you enjoy about it?
I enjoy being a part of events and projects that strengthen our parent community and deepen our relationship as parents with the school. I also like the affiliation with the PTO, hearing from the administrators, knowing about different things going on in the district as well as where all the fundraising dollars go.

Meet Chris Acampora - a tireless parent volunteer who will always find the extra time to help, whether it is something planned or last minute. As a full time working mom, she still supports PTO out wherever help is needed and we appreciate each year that we get to spend with her! 


**ALL ABOUT CHRIS**

​Her children:
Weston - sophomore,  
Carly - 6th grade, 
Aubrey - 1st grade

Her position on the PTO Board:
Chair of 6th Gr Spring Fling,
Chair of 4th grade State Fair,
Chair of DW Pizza Sales.

Employment status:
I own an online website membership company that teaches chiropractors how to integrate with medical professionals. I write monthly for the American Chiropractic Associations magazine ACA Today and I speak for state and national conferences.

How do you fit in PTO projects into your routine?
I pick projects that appeal to me personally (I tend to gravitate towards social studies) and I take on roles that allow for some work to be done as time allows and have longer planning cycles. 

What do you enjoy about it?
I love working with my friends, I mostly love watching the end results and seeing the kids enjoy the events.
